From: Icenowy Zheng Date: Tue, 17 Sep 2024 09:40:08 +0000 (+0800) Subject: dt-bindings: usb: genesys,gl850g: allow downstream device subnodes X-Git-Tag: v6.13-rc1~31^2~132 X-Git-Url: https://git.kernel.dk/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=570542810fe539af57a5b9169d79c8b31e83d9d0;p=linux-block.git dt-bindings: usb: genesys,gl850g: allow downstream device subnodes As this binding describes USB hubs, it's natural for them to have downstream devices. Change "additionalProperties" to "unevaluatedProperties" to allow properties defined in usb-device.yaml (for DT cells properties) and add a pattern-based downstream device subnode rule to match those subnodes. These changes allow downstream devices get defined under the hub.
